Chief Secretary Dr. Shrikant Baldi chaired the meeting to chalk out a road map for setting up rehabilitation homes for people who have recovered from mental illness and are still in hospitals. The meeting was organised by Social Justice and Empowerment (SJE) Department.

Dr. Baldi said that the State Government would fund the Non Governmental Organisations for setting up of rehabilitation homes for persons who have recovered from mental illness. He said that the State Government would fund for establishing ‘Halfway Homes’, less restrictive transitional living facilities, to ensure the well being of persons who have recovered from ailment.

“Halfway Homes is proposed by state government” said Chief Secretary. The Social Justice and Empowerment department has proposed to set up atleast two Rehabilitation Homes in the State, he added.

Due to social stigma, the persons, who are fit to be discharged, are forced to live in different mental hospitals and institutes. He said that setting up of these homes would provide required healthy environment for such persons.

Additional Chief Secretary Social Justice and Empowerment Nisha Singh ,Additional Chief Secretary Health R.D. Dhiman and other senior officers of SJE and Health were also present in the meeting.
